有机硅集水措施对作物生长影响试验研究

Study on the Effects of Organic Silicon Catchment Methods on Crop Growth in Sloping Fields
下载PDF
导出
摘要 采用有机硅喷涂、拍光压实及自然坡面3种集流措施收集雨水,研究在不同集流措施下种植带内水分动态变化,以及对作物生长发育的影响。结果表明,有机硅喷涂措施在作物生长季节能大大提高种植带内的土壤含水量和集水量。 The effects of catchments methods on water potential and growth of crop planted in sloping fields were studied in loess plateau of shannxi povince. The different way to rainwater catchments, for example spraying the new-type macromolecule organic silicon on the tamped slope surface, the tamped slope surface and the nature slope surface, under the slope, to determine soil water and growth of crop at timing. The experiments showed that the compacted surface soil slope with organic silicon chemical treatment catched much rainwater harvesting , to promote the crop growth. The mass was 1.1 times as the compacted surface soil slope, was 1. 5 times as the nature slope.
